NEMCC Adult Education Student Zachary Johnson Earns High School Equivalency Diploma
Zachary Johnson, an adult education student at Northeast Mississippi Community College in Booneville, has earned his high school equivalency diploma, college officials announced.
Johnson’s achievement reflects his dedication and perseverance, according to college officials. The milestone opens new opportunities for him and signifies progress toward his educational and career goals.
